| Keterangan: | UPDATE-MOZILLAFIREFOX Mengunduh daftar nomor versi Firefox terbaru yang dengannya membandingkan nomor versi Firefox yang ditemukan pada sistem dan menampilkan, apakah pembaruan Firefox diperlukan atau tidak. UPDATE-MOZILLAFIREFOX Mendeteksi firefox yang diinstal dengan menanyakan Windows Registry untuk program yang diinstal. Kunci dari HKLM:SoftwareWow6432NodeMicrosoftWindowsCurrentVersionUninstall dan HKLM:SoftwareMicrosoftWindowsCurrentVersionUninstall adalah komputer 64-bit, dan pada 32-bit-satu-satunya komputer latter latter hanya latter 32-bit. jalur diakses. At Step 7 Update-MozillaFirefox downloads and writes several Firefox-related files, namely " firefox_current_versions.json ", " firefox_release_history.json ", " firefox_major_versions.json ", " firefox_languages.json " and " firefox_regions.json ", which Update-MozillaFirefox menggunakan sebagai sumber data. Saat dijalankan di jendela PowerShell yang 'normal', dan semua versi Firefox yang terdeteksi tampaknya terkini, pembaruan-Mozillafirefox hanya akan memeriksa bahwa semuanya baik-baik saja dan pergi tanpa upacara lebih lanjut pada langkah 11. Jika pembaruan-mozillafirefox dijalankan tanpa hak tinggi (tetapi dengan koneksi internet yang berfungsi) di mesin dengan versi Firefox lama, akan ditunjukkan bahwa pembaruan Firefox diperlukan, tetapi pembaruan-mozillafirefox akan keluar pada langkah 12 sebelum mengunduh file apa pun . Untuk melakukan pembaruan dengan pembaruan-mozillafirefox, PowerShell harus dijalankan di jendela yang ditinggikan (dijalankan sebagai administrator). Jika pembaruan-mozillafirefox dijalankan di jendela PowerShell yang ditinggikan dan tidak ada Firefox yang terdeteksi, skrip menawarkan opsi untuk menginstal Firefox di " sudut admin " (langkah 11), di mana, bertentangan dengan sifat otonom utama pembaruan-Mozillafirefox, Input pengguna akhir diperlukan untuk memilih versi bit dan bahasa. Di "Corner Admin", satu contoh versi 32-bit atau 64-bit dalam salah satu bahasa yang tersedia dapat diinstal dengan pembaruan-mozillafirefox-pilihan bahasa mencakup lebih dari 30 bahasa. Dalam prosedur pembaruan itu sendiri pembaruan-mozillafirefox mengunduh penginstal Firefox lengkap dari Mozilla, yang sama dengan jenis yang sudah diinstal pada sistem (versi bit yang sama dan bahasa). Setelah menulis file konfigurasi instalasi ( firefox_configuration.ini ke $path pada langkah 14, di mana, misalnya, layanan pemeliharaan mozilla otomatis dinonaktifkan dan pintasan default diaktifkan) dan menghentikan beberapa proses yang terkait dengan firefox, pembaruan-mozillafirefox menginstal yang diunduh The Downloaded Firefox di atas instalasi Firefox yang ada, yang memicu prosedur pembaruan Firefox yang dibangun. |